Automatic robot stud welding on car bodies requires precise location of the car in three spaces. This paper describes the vision system utilized to locate a car by referencing door corners. The reference points are used to calculate a robot trajectory for the stud weld operation. The paper begins with a set of objectives and constraints for the vision system. A description of the vision system follows. The utilization of a combination of structured light and diffuse flood lighting is shown to be a solution to the unique constraints of the system. Finally, comments on system performance and installation difficulties are presented.
